|░ Certification ░|
All jadeite pieces are sourced from Guangdong's Sihui and Jieyang, major jadeite hubs, from reputable merchants. They undergo inspection by instruments and professionals. After procurement, items are examined under UV light, and samples from each batch are sent to the Taipei Gemstone Testing Center for authentication.

Currently, over 40 minerals have been identified in jadeite. Its chemical composition is Sodium Aluminum Silicate (NaAI[Si2O6]), often containing trace elements such as Calcium (Ca), Chromium (Cr), Nickel (Ni), Manganese (Mn), Magnesium (Mg), and Iron (Fe).
White: Essentially free of impurities.
Red: Contains trivalent iron.
Black: Contains over 2% chromium.
Green: Contains over 2% chromium and divalent iron.
Yellow: Contains iron.
Purple: Contains manganese.
Blue: Similar to green, but rarer.
